This is a very expensive and deceptive ticket sales site.
Expense: Ticketmaster, which is known for its high service fees, generally charges 11-12% total as service charges.
I purchased a $254 item for a performance at the Majestic Theater on TicketsOffices.com and was charged $75 in service fees and charges 30% of the total order.
Deceptive: In the center of the screen is a large window asking a customer for identifying information, a delivery method (such as email), and the item charge (in this case $254).
Underneath that is a large button asking for credit card or PayPal information, followed by a button to complete the sale.
Throughout the process, the charge shown in that window does not change.
However, the company adds the large (30%) service fees in a smaller window on the right-hand side of the screen.
So when looking at the summary of charges in the center of the screen, there is no indication of a service charge. One has to use his/her peripheral vision to find the additional charges.
I knew such sites add service fees, but since the price in the main window never changes, I assumed the service fees were folded into the price or else would show up in PayPal before I submitted the order.
Once you hit the button to complete the sale the sale is final. I tried to cancel through the company's chat function immediately but no.
Legitimate online sites give people 20-30 minutes to cancel the charges.

I was looking for tickets to the 2018 charity event "Guns vs Hoses" at Baxter Arena in Omaha. The top link via Bing included the words Baxter Arena followed by "ticketoffices".
Here is the actual link: "baxterarena.ticketoffices.com/Guns+and+Hoses"
I selected that link, and purchased the tickets.
I soon realized that the ticketoffices.com link and website was not connected to the arena.
I called the ticketoffices CS line and informed the CS rep of the issue, that this was a charity event for local police and firefighters and that i would like a refund. Since the tickets they sold me were over twice the face value of the event. (when you include the $11 per ticket service fee)
They refused a refund, and pointed to a disclaimer beside the green button i had clicked to purchase the tickets. I had to return to the original link to see the disclaimer which states that they are not associated with the arena which is embedded in the link.
I buy tickets online all of the time. Never before have i been charged. An $11 service fee per ticket for a ticket that is TWICE the face value FOR A CHARITY EVENT.
I refused to use the tickets, we later purchased tickets through the Baxter box office so that a majority of the money goes to the event and not a third party ticket scammer.
I call this a scam because this third-party ticket retailer is in the business of making their site and links include key words and look as close to a real business as possible, then refusing a refund once tickets are purchased (which is automatic via paypal.)
